BGE PARENT INVOLVEMENT
 
Bell Gardens Elementary School recognizes that a critical part of effective schooling is parent involvement. Parent Involvement refers to the efforts of any caregiver who has responsibility for caring for a child, including parents, grandparents, aunts, uncles, foster parents, stepparents, etc. The school and the home cannot be looked at in isolation from one another; families and schools need to collaborate to help children adjust to the responsibilities of being successful students.
 
At BGE, we believe that a child's caregiver plays a valuable role in the life of the school and the student. Their participation enriches the vision of the school because of the breadth of experience and new perspectives that they may provide to the school. According to research, there is a link between parent involvement and improvement on a child's academic, achievement, attendance, and attitude.
